PB 電子会議室
発言No. | 更新日 | 題名(クリックすると発言内容と関連するコメントが表示されます) |
---|---|---|
23375 | 08/08/06 15:09:55 | RE(2):PB7.3からPB11.1にバージョンアップ後にDBとの接続がうまくいかない。 By ismbs |
23374 | 08/08/06 12:25:32 | RE(1):PB7.3からPB11.1にバージョンアップ後にDBとの接続がうまくいかない。 By ace |
23371 | 08/08/05 19:50:27 | PB7.3からPB11.1にバージョンアップ後にDBとの接続がうまくいかない。 By ismbs |
カテゴリ:データベース
日付:2008年08月06日 15:09 発信者:ismbs
題名:RE(2):PB7.3からPB11.1にバージョンアップ後にDBとの接続がうまくいかない。
aceさん、こんにちは。
わかりやすい説明ありがとうございます。aceさんのおっしゃる通り7のロジックそのままだったので
sqlca.database=DB名となっていました。
プレビュータブを参考にsqlca.dbparm=\"database=\'DB名\'\"としたところ、データを抽出することができまし
た。
私のわかりにくい説明に対して的確に答えて頂きとても感謝しております。今後も行き詰ったときにご教授願
えればと思います。ありがとうございました。
>ismbsさん、こんにちは。
>恐らくですが、SNC接続の際、DBが指定されていないからだと思います。
>11ですと、SQLCA.Database=DB名ではなく
>SQLCA.dbParm = \"\'PROVIDERSTRING=\'Database=DB名\'\"
>で接続しないと、対象DBの参照にはなりません、もっとも
>DB名.スキーマー名.テーブル名(例 master.dbo.sysobjects)となっていれば別ですが、いかがでしょうか?
>後、OLE ODBCの現象はもう少しお聞きしなければわかりませんが、SQLServerであれば、OLE ODBCより
>OLE Micrsoft OLE DB の方がよろしいかと思います。
>上記いずれの場合もデータベースペインタでプロファイルを作成し接続確認後、対象のプロファイルのプロ
パテ
>ィで、プレビュータブを表示すると構文がわかりやすいと思います。
付加情報:
PowerBuilder Version (記載なし)
Client SoftWare
OS Windows XP
DBMS Microsoft SQL Server Client 2000
Browser (記載なし)
Server SoftWare
O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)
Copyright © 2013 Power Future Co., Ltd.